Login
Search the gallery
Home
Vespa Obsession
OTLEY TO YEADON 2007
i283629826 51221 6
Previous
52 of 80
Next
i283629826 51221 6
Comments
No comments yet.
View comments on this item
Photo info
Title:
i283629826 51221 6
File name:
i283629826_51221_6.jpg
Random image